Obituary reprinted with permission from Zabka Funeral Home in Seward, NE:

Dale Lee “Nigel” Grigsby was born January 16, 1950 at Seward, Nebraska, the son of John Paul and Goldie Florence (Brandenburgh) Grigsby and passed away on October 9, 2014 in Minneapolis, Minnesota at the age of 64 years, 10 months, 23 days. Dale was a 1968 graduate of Seward High School and a 1972 graduate of the Minneapolis School of Fine Arts. He traveled extensively in Europe and the United States. Dale was a lifelong artist, writer, poet and community activist.
He was preceded in death by his parents, John and Goldie Grisby and his sister-in-law, LeAnn Grigsby.
Survivors include his brothers and sister-in-law, Thomas of Seward, Dr. Donald and Judith Grigsby of Columbus, Georgia; a niece, Becky Banks, and nephew, Eric Grigsby; his life partner, Gregory VanderPloeg; other relatives and a host of friends.
Memorial services were held Friday, October 17, 2014 in Minneapolis, Minnesota. Inurnment in the Seward Cemetery, Seward, Nebraska. Memorials maybe directed to the Grigsby family % Zabka Funeral Home, Seward.
